
Titans will be the first live action show to premiere on DC Universe, but filming is currently underway for the next one: Doom Patrol.
The first photos have surfaced from the Doom Patrol set this past Friday and give us our first look at Robotman, Negative Man, Elasti-Girl and Crazy Jane. You can check them out over at Just Jared.

Meanwhile, Deadline is reporting that Alan Tudyk has been cast as the Doom Patrol villain, Eric Morden… aka Mr. Nobody. Here is his official character description: After exposure to unknown experiments by ex-Nazis in post-war Paraguay, the man formerly known as Eric Morden emerges as a living shadow able to drain the sanity of others as the enigmatic, and totally insane, Mr. Nobody.
